原文:Android函数抽取壳的实现

x 前言 函数抽取壳这个词不知道从哪起源的,但我理解的函数抽取壳是那种将dex文件中的函数代码给nop,然后在运行时再把字节码给填回dex的这么一种壳。 函数抽取前: 函数抽取后: 很早之前就想写这类的壳,最近终于把它做出来了,取名为dpt。现在将代码分享出来,欢迎把玩。项目地址:https: github.com luoyesiqiu dpt shell x 项目的结构 dpt代码分为两个部分 ...

2022-01-15 12:39 8 1574 推荐指数:

查看详情

android apk

  对于有过pc端加解密经验的同学来说并不陌生,android世界中的也是相同的存在。看下图(exe = dex):      概念清楚罗,我们就说下:最本质的功能就是实现加载器。你看加后,系统是先执行代码的。但我们想要的是执行原dex,可是系统此时是不会自动来执行的需要 ...

Thu Sep 17 00:48:00 CST 2015 0 1956
android so入口浅析

本文转自http://www.9hao.info/pages/2014/08/android-soke-ru-kou-q 前言   开年来开始接触一些加固样本,基本都对了so进行了处理,拖入ida一看,要么没有 JNI_OnLoad ,要么 JNI_OnLoad 汇编代码羞涩难懂 ...

Mon Sep 22 08:16:00 CST 2014 0 2157
AndroidApp Demo

接上一篇... 本篇也是Android 应用安全防护和逆向分析的一个demo源码实现, 因为书中写的源码地址找不到,写的也是csdn的,下载极其不便,所以便想参考书里内容写一个上传开源。 加app主要有三部分,1. 源app 2. 加app 3. 加工具 其实就是把源apk加一层 ...

Tue Jan 22 02:56:00 CST 2019 0 652
Android中的Apk的加固(加)原理解析和实现(转)

一、前言 今天又到周末了,憋了好久又要出博客了,今天来介绍一下Android中的如何对Apk进行加固的原理。现阶段。我们知道Android中的反编译工作越来越让人操作熟练,我们辛苦的开发出一个apk,结果被人反编译了,那心情真心不舒服。虽然我们混淆,做到native层,但是这都是治标不治本 ...

Tue Sep 15 18:04:00 CST 2015 0 10615
android黑科技系列——Apk的加固(加)原理解析和实现

一、前言 今天又到周末了,憋了好久又要出博客了,今天来介绍一下Android中的如何对Apk进行加固的原理。现阶段。我们知道Android中的反编译工作越来越让人操作熟练,我们辛苦的开发出一个apk,结果被人反编译了,那心情真心不舒服。虽然我们混淆,做到native层,但是这都是治标不治本 ...

Sun Nov 12 05:48:00 CST 2017 1 1871
软件加的原理及实现

实现 我是个初学者,所知有限,难免会有错误,如果有人发现了错误,还请指正。先大致说一下加的原理,即在原PE文件(后面称之为宿主文件)上加一个新的区段(也就是),然后从这个新的区段上开始运行;也就算是成功的加上了;下面我们就说一下具体的实现。这个工程有两个项目,一个用来生成 ...

Mon Feb 28 22:30:00 CST 2022 0 751
Android逆向 -- 内存Dump法(初代

▼更多精彩推荐,请关注我们 通过一道CTF题,来初步掌握手脱一代-内存Dump法 快来跟布布解锁新姿势吧。 内存Dump法 题目来自: 2014 alictf APK第三题 首先拿到APK,查。 发现加了,想到是多年前的题 ...

Sun Oct 04 10:44:00 CST 2020 0 617
【原创】Android VMP加 POC

介绍 这个的核心——字节码解释器,它参考了dalvik虚拟机的解释器。不需要hook、注入。目前只支持算数运算指令。 我个人把dalviki指令分为这么几类: 算数运算指令。 引用类指令。如const-string、invoke-kind,这类指令需要引用dex的资源。 其他指 ...

Tue Apr 07 15:54:00 CST 2015 1 6827
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M